Sound the trumpets, ring the bells and fire the cannons – Here 2015 officially launches today! Our one-day symposium featuring the some of the world’s most exciting creative talent returns to the splendid surroundings of the Royal Geographical Society in west London on Friday 12 June.

And today we are thrilled to unveil the first set of speakers who’ll be joining us in the summer, and to announce that tickets for the event are now on sale. We are proud to present digital guru Iain Tait, artist and designer Scott King, SHOWstudio editor Lou Stoppard, photographic duo Blommers Schumm, karlssonwilker’s Hjalti Karlsson and ManvsMachine founder Mike Alderson.

We’ll also be welcoming set designer Anna Lomax, illustrator Jordy van den Nieuwendijk, graphic designer Charlotte Heal and Nathan Cowen and Jacob Klein, the brains behind Haw-lin.

Tickets for Here 2015 are available now, priced at £99 for earlybirds, £75 for students, standard tickets at £125 and group tickets for five or more delegates at £99.
